The Surge in Solar Energy Adoption
Over the past decade, solar energy installations have skyrocketed. According to the International Energy Agency (IEA), global solar capacity reached a staggering 1,000 gigawatts (GW) in 2022, marking a 25% increase from the previous year. This remarkable growth is attributed to several factors:
- Declining Costs: The price of solar panels has plummeted by 82% since 2010, making solar energy more affordable for homeowners and businesses.
- Government Incentives: Many countries offer tax credits, rebates, and grants, encouraging the adoption of solar technology.
- Environmental Awareness: Growing concerns about climate change have prompted individuals and corporations to seek cleaner energy alternatives.

Benefits of Solar Power
Solar power presents numerous advantages. Firstly, it significantly reduces greenhouse gas emissions, helping to mitigate climate change. The U.S. Environmental Protection Agency (EPA) estimates that solar energy can reduce carbon dioxide emissions by nearly 90% compared to fossil fuels.
Additionally, solar energy enhances energy independence. By harnessing sunlight, countries can decrease reliance on imported fuels, bolstering national security. Furthermore, job creation in the solar industry has surged, with over 250,000 jobs created in the U.S. alone in 2022.
Challenges Facing Solar Energy
Despite its benefits, solar energy faces several challenges. One major hurdle is intermittency; solar power generation fluctuates based on weather conditions and time of day. This inconsistency necessitates reliable energy storage systems to ensure a steady power supply.
Moreover, the initial installation costs, although decreasing, can still be a barrier for many homeowners. “While solar energy is becoming more accessible, it still requires an upfront investment that not everyone can afford,” states Mark Jensen, a financial analyst specializing in renewable energy.
Technological Innovations on the Horizon
Innovations in solar technology hold the key to overcoming current challenges. Advancements in energy storage solutions, such as lithium-ion batteries, are crucial for addressing intermittency. Researchers are also exploring new materials, like perovskite solar cells, which promise higher efficiency and lower manufacturing costs.
Furthermore, smart grid technology enables better integration of renewable energy sources, allowing for more efficient energy distribution. The U.S. Department of Energy reports that integrating smart grids could increase the share of renewables in the energy mix by up to 30% by 2030.
Global Perspectives on Solar Energy
Different regions are adopting solar energy at varying rates. Countries like China and Germany lead the world in solar installations, driven by strong government policies and public support. In contrast, many developing nations face barriers such as insufficient infrastructure and funding.
